LIGhT THERAPIES
Defines medical necessity criteria, investigational/excluded uses, device and course limits, and eligible diagnoses for ultraviolet B (UVB) phototherapy, psoralen plus UVA (PUVA), targeted phototherapy (including 308 nm excimer laser/lamp), Goeckerman therapy, and home phototherapy for Capital BlueCross products (policy MP 2.046).
